Output 64f49cc32014a9950366206452608e2f9a6c9e8c3bf80f13594ccd5e3a2025c7:0

value
17900
script pubkey
OP_0 OP_PUSHBYTES_20 1b4ae2dfd6850c48f87d27967c766ed321904d41
address
bc1qrd9w9h7ks5xy37ray7t8canw6vseqn2pufezhw
transaction
64f49cc32014a9950366206452608e2f9a6c9e8c3bf80f13594ccd5e3a2025c7
confirmations
294908
spent
true